Crème de Banana is a popular liqueur with many uses. It can be used to enhance any dessert, drink or cake which uses bananas. Crème de Banana can be made from whole bananas the results are quite different though. The flavor is very heavy and the smell pungent, and also difficult to filter. I have chosen to use an imitation banana extract which is readily available. Tastes just like  DeKuyper's® Crème de Banana. Simple and unique try it.

Recipe

Crème de Banana has many uses. It can be added to any dessert, cake, drink or anything that requires bananas for an extra kick. Tastes just like DeKuyper's® Crème de Banana. Simple and unique—try it.

9.3 oz., (275 ml.) 153° proof Vodka or Everclear (non-flavored)
5 tsp., (25 ml.) banana extract (Schilling® brand is fine)
6.7 oz., (198 ml.) water (use distilled water)
8.5 oz., (251 ml.) simple syrup
1 drop yellow food color
14 drops caramel color (optional)

• Make in the bottle in which is will be stored. Add alcohol, water and syrup to the bottle, shake well. Add extract and color and again shake well. No aging required. That is all it takes—It is ready to enjoy!

28% Alc. by Vol. (56°). Makes 750 ml.
